v2. Fix date-stamp regression in erc-track. Optionally reinstate old "prepended" date-stamp behavior gated by new compat var. Earlier changes for this feature introduced a regression involving date stamps and the option `erc-track-exclude-types'. Basically, date stamps aren't supposed to affect the mode line, at least so long as their inciting message's command appears in `erc-track-exclude-types'. However, this changed after c68dc7786fc * Manage some text props for ERC insertion-hook members To reproduce from -Q: 1. Connect and ensure "JOIN" appears in `erc-track-exclude-types' 2. Join #chan 3. From the server buffer, do (with-current-buffer "#chan" (setq erc-timestamp-last-inserted-left nil)) 3. Connect and join #chan from another client 4. Notice a [#c] in the mode line of the original client Thanks to Corwin for pointing this out. The way I'm proposing we tackle this is to decouple date stamps from `erc-track-exclude-types' completely. That is, have erc-track completely ignore them, so they never affect the mode line. In addition to this fix, I've also added a path for accessing the old behavior in which date stamps aren't standalone messages.
